Yogyakarta is renowned for its ancient temples, such as Borobudur and Prambanan, which are UNESCO World Heritage Sites. These architectural wonders not only provide insight into the region’s past but also offer breathtaking views and incredible photo opportunities. One of the highlights of a Yogyakarta tour package from Malaysia is the opportunity to experience the city’s vibrant art scene. Yogyakarta is known as the cultural capital of Indonesia, and it is home to numerous art galleries, studios, and traditional craft villages. Travelers can witness the creation of batik, a traditional Indonesian textile, and even try their hand at creating their own design. The city is also famous for its shadow puppetry, known as wayang kulit. A visit to a traditional puppet workshop can provide a unique insight into this ancient art form.
Yogyakarta is not only known for its cultural heritage but also for its natural beauty. The city is surrounded by stunning landscapes, including Mount Merapi, an active volcano. Adventurous travelers can embark on a hiking expedition to the volcano’s summit and witness breathtaking sunrise views from the top. Food lovers will find themselves in paradise in Yogyakarta. The city is renowned for its street food scene, offering a wide array of flavors and dishes. From the famous Gudeg, a traditional Javanese dish made from young jackfruit, to the mouthwatering Bakpia, a sweet pastry filled with mung bean paste, Yogyakarta’s culinary delights are sure to tantalize your taste buds.
